黑马程序员技术交流社区

标题: 分享一个 思路不错的 用 if比较三个数大小的小代码 [打印本页]

作者: wankaz    时间: 2015-8-30 22:58
标题: 分享一个 思路不错的 用 if比较三个数大小的小代码
public static void compIf() {
                Scanner sc = new Scanner(System.in);//键盘录入三个数
                int x = sc.nextInt();
                int y = sc.nextInt();
                int z = sc.nextInt();

                if(x > y && x > z) {
                        System.out.println("最大值是:" + x);
                } else if(y < z) {   // 此时x>y,则x<z或x<y均可
                        System.out.println("最大值是:" + z);
                } else {
                        System.out.println("最大值是:" + y);
                }
                       
        }
作者: Glc90    时间: 2015-8-30 23:28
System.out.print( "最大值"+( x > y ) ? ( ( x > z ) ? x : z ) : ( ( y > z ) ? y : z ) );




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2